LESS'те селекторлорду туташтыруу
Кээде бизге киргизилген конструкциялар компиляцияланганда ачык эмес, бирдикте болушун каалайбыз. Бул үчүн киргизилген селектордун атынын алдында амперсанд коюу керек:
div {
&.block {
width: 300px;
}
}
Натыйжада компиляциядан кийин төмөнкү код алынат:
div.block {
width: 300px;
}
Төмөнкү коддун компиляция натыйжасы кандай болорун айтып бер:
#block {
&.xxx {
width: 300px;
}
}
Төмөнкү коддун компиляция натыйжасы кандай болорун айтып бер:
#block {
.xxx {
width: 300px;
}
}
Төмөнкү коддун компиляция натыйжасы кандай болорун айтып бер:
#block {
&.xxx {
&.zzz {
width: 300px;
}
}
}
Төмөнкү коддун компиляция натыйжасы кандай болорун айтып бер:
#block {
&.xxx {
.zzz {
width: 300px;
}
}
}
Төмөнкү коддун компиляция натыйжасы кандай болорун айтып бер:
#block {
.xxx {
&.zzz {
width: 300px;
}
}
}